Divine Union

Divine union The crown of the stars, The night-goddess wears, Brighter than the diamond studs, Each luminary shimmers. His bright rays and home in Heaven, Leaves in oblivion the setting Sun, Avid for union with the Night, Bids adieu to the sky bright The glittering Sun bright, And the dark Starry-Night, Aspiring for inseparable union, The Unity of duality staggers imagination!
